We are looking for inquisitive and driven full-time software engineers with a strong interest in building high-quality, long-lasting systems. The VLSI Productivity and Infrastructure team supports hundreds of chip design engineers by building internal tools and platforms that supercharge their everyday work. From build automation to machine learning, databases to web applications, and on-prem compute to cloud workloads, this team handles it all.

What you'll be doing:

  • Design and develop innovative AI-driven web products to solve big data challenges in chip design. Build high performance API's, data pipelines and backend services in a distributed systems environment.

  • Own technical strategy for broad and complex challenges. Collaborate closely with product and engineering teams to translate high-level requirements into actionable deliverables. Handle multiple tasks and adapt to changing priorities.

  • Be an engineering generalist. Discover and build skills needed at different times to solve the problems at hand.

What we need to see: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field (or equivalent experience).

  • 6+ years of professional experience in full-stack development.

  • Strong fundamentals in data structures, algorithms and software design patterns.

  • Experience building web apps with modern frameworks, tooling and design libraries (ReactJS preferred).

  • Experience building scalable API’s and backend systems (NodeJS and/or Python preferred).

  • Background with data storage solutions and query optimization approaches (e.g. MySQL, MongoDB, Elasticsearch, AWS S3, etc.).

Ways to stand out from the crowd:

  • A passion for well-written code, test-driven development and engineering best practices.

  • Strong problem solving and interpersonal skills, self-motivated, and a team player.

  • Strong ability to build functional and intuitive user experiences.

  • A zeal to learn and perform beyond prior experience and expertise.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
